Since the beginning of the Market Conduct Annual Statement program as a pilot project, property/casualty companies have filed the MCAS by April 30 each year while life/annuity companies were given until June 30 to make their submissions. During the past year, as a result of the ongoing development at the NAIC of a new system to accommodate MCAS filings for all jurisdictions, NAIC staff has recommended that a single filing date be adopted for MCAS filing by all companies.
